Need For Speed’s widely-criticised ‘rubber banding’ AI is to be patched in a future game update, developer Ghost Games has confirmed.

The new patch, which Ghost expects to release before the end of November, will provide “more balanced ‘AI Catch Up'” to help ensure players aren’t unfairly overtaken by rival AI racers.

The patch will also include the “first look” at neons, increase the REP cap from 50 to 60 and introduce 3 new Trophies and Achievements. You can catch a brief look at all the planned changes below.

  • More balanced ‘AI Catch Up’
  • New Wrap Editor features: Mirror functionality, Improved colour picker
  • Hoonicorn and Morohoshi-San Diablo gifted upon completion of their respective narrative threads
  • First look at neons
  • Early in development version on Morohoshi-San’s Diablo
  • REP increase 50-60
  • 3x Trophies & Achievements
  • New daily challenges
  • x30 new pre-set wraps
  • General bugs, tweaks and improvements

The patch is the first of multiple game updates heading to Need For Speed, which are expected to introduce a “substantial amount” of free DLC.

Need For Speed is available now on Xbox One and PS4, with a PC version due to follow in early 2016.
